Prep Time: 15 Minutes Cook Time: 60 Minutes |
Ready In: 75 Minutes Servings: 4 |
|
This is a wonderful seafood stew and quick to make but tastes wonderful. Its easy to make and would make a great meal with a rolls to soak up the juice from the stew Ingredients:
2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il |
1 cup diced celery |
1/2 cup diced onion |
1 bay leaf |
32 ounces fish stock (your choice) or 32 ounces clam juice (your choice) |
1 cup white wine |
28 ounces crushed tomatoes |
8 ounces shrimp |
8 ounces scallops |
1 lb red snapper or 1 lb halibut, cut into chunks |
1 tablespoon chopped parsley (preferably fresh) |
Directions:
1. Saute celery and onion in olive oil to softened. 2. Add bay leaf, wine and fish stock reducing by half. 3. Add tomato sauce and bring to a simmer for about 20-30 minutes. 4. Add all your seafood and simmer for 15 minutes longer. Add salt and pepper to taste. 5. Add fresh parsley for garnish. 6. Serve with crusty rolls 7. Enjoy! |
